Output d2c1c9043f2011c294c7eab111a02145cd2aa3e9cc5259cda807b3c6d522d232:1

value
13039706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f18a2c41cb750366d3e884433f4721fef4bef707 OP_EQUAL
address
3PiAJCFdZRi7qSDMkehTE6QGLbnLEkna9Y
transaction
d2c1c9043f2011c294c7eab111a02145cd2aa3e9cc5259cda807b3c6d522d232
confirmations
203099
spent
true